About 4A6

Scottsboro Municipal-Word Field (4A6) is an airport in Scottsboro, AL, at 650 ft MSL. It has 1 runway, the longest 5,240 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led). This page shows live METAR/TAF weather, runway crosswinds, frequencies, navaids, and FAA charts for 4A6, refreshed from the Aviation Weather Center and FAA NASR.

Does 4A6 have a control tower?

No. Scottsboro Municipal-Word Field is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) airport; use the published CTAF/UNICOM in the Comms & NavAids section.

What is the longest runway at 4A6?

Scottsboro Municipal-Word Field has 1 runway; the longest is 5,240 ft. See the Runways section for headings, surface, and lighting.

Where is 4A6?

Scottsboro Municipal-Word Field is in Scottsboro, AL, at an elevation of 650 ft MSL. Coordinates: 34.6887, -86.0059.
